The cheapest way to get from Monte Carlo to Warsaw is to fly which costs 260 zł - 1 000 zł and takes 5h 44m.
The fastest way to get from Monte Carlo to Warsaw is to fly which takes 5h 44m and costs 260 zł - 1 000 zł.
No, there is no direct train from Monte Carlo to Warsaw. However, there are services departing from Monaco-Monte-Carlo and arriving at Warszawa Centralna via Nice Ville, Strasbourg Bahnhof, S+U Gesundbrunnen Bhf and Rzepin.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 24h 26m.
The distance between Monte Carlo and Warsaw is 1427 km. The road distance is 1756.1 km.
The best way to get from Monte Carlo to Warsaw without a car is to train which takes 24h 26m and costs 1 800 zł - 5 500 zł.
It takes approximately 5h 44m to get from Monte Carlo to Warsaw, including transfers.
Monte Carlo to Warsaw train services, operated by TGV inOui, depart from Nice Ville station.
The best way to get from Monte Carlo to Warsaw is to fly which takes 5h 44m and costs 260 zł - 1 000 zł. Alternatively, you can train, which costs 1 800 zł - 5 500 zł and takes 24h 26m.
Monte Carlo to Warsaw train services, operated by TGV inOui, arrive at Strasbourg station.
Yes, the driving distance between Monte Carlo to Warsaw is 1756 km. It takes approximately 17h 7m to drive from Monte Carlo to Warsaw.
What companies run services between Monte Carlo, Monaco and Warsaw, Poland?
Wizz Air, LOT, and two other airlines fly from Nice Côte D'Azur International Airport (NCE) to Warsaw Chopin Airport (WAW) every 4 hours. Alternatively, you can take a train from Monaco-Monte-Carlo to Warszawa Centralna via Nice Ville, Strasbourg, Strasbourg Bahnhof, S+U Gesundbrunnen Bhf, and Rzepin in around 24h 26m.
